Output e4c6e23cc5e01b9838875b19e90f21330f34c3a9906d2dfbf1e5ffb88dafc786:9

value
2645221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02fdd0ce8e4228c9893a42bfca0523aa639e16b3 OP_EQUAL
address
31xqLM9ARk434ehZ9csQDSX5pcBWrQynxR
transaction
e4c6e23cc5e01b9838875b19e90f21330f34c3a9906d2dfbf1e5ffb88dafc786
confirmations
278148
spent
true